The
49ers recently lost backup Kendall Hunter for the season but remain stocked at running back with younger talent like
LaMichael James and
Anthony Dixon. A regular fixture on the inactive list, Jacobs finally lost his cool last week,
complaining he was "rotting away" by the Bay. He has five carries all season.
